The flag handling (both compiler options and include paths) are a mess at the moment. There is no point in forcing "-O2 -g" when these are already the defaults, and if someone changes the defaults, chances are good they don't want you clobbering their choices. The -Wall flag should be handled in configure and thrown into CFLAGS once rather than every Makefile.am. Plus, this way we can control which compilers the flag actually gets used with. Finally, the INCLUDES variable is for -I paths, not AM_CFLAGS. Nor should it contain -I. as this is already in the default includes setup. Signed-off-by:

If the client asked for an encoding, and no enabled extension handled it, LibVNCServer would walk through all extensions, and if they promised to handle the encoding, execute the extension's newClient() if it was not NULL. However, if newClient is not NULL, it will be called when a client connects, and if it returns TRUE, the extension will be enabled. Since all the state of the extension should be in the client data, there is no good reason why newClient should return FALSE the first time (thus not enabling the extension), but TRUE when called just before calling enablePseudoEncoding(). So in effect, the extension got enabled all the time, even if that was not necessary. The resolution is to pass a void** to enablePseudoEncoding. This has the further advantage that enablePseudoEncoding can remalloc() or free() the data without problems. Though keep in mind that if enablePseudoEncoding() is called on a not-yet-enabled extension, the passed data points to NULL.

do not make requestedRegion empty without reason. the cursor handling for clients which don't handle CursorShape updates was completely broken. It originally was very complicated for performance reasons, however, in most cases it made performance even worse, because at idle times there was way too much checking going on, and furthermore, sometimes unnecessary updates were inevitable. The code now is much more elegant: the ClientRec structure knows exactly where it last painted the cursor, and the ScreenInfo structure knows where the cursor shall be. As a consequence there is no more rfbDrawCursor()/rfbUndrawCursor(), no more dontSendFramebufferUpdate, and no more isCursorDrawn. It is now possible to have clients which understand CursorShape updates and clients which don't at the same time. rfbSetCursor no longer has the option freeOld; this is obsolete, as the cursor structure knows what to free and what not.
